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: 1. Patients with ARDS as per Berlin definition of ARDS (acute in onset, meaning onset over 1 week or less, bilateral opacities must be present and may be detected on chest radiograph, PaO2/FiO2 ratio {PEEP}, and must not be fully explained by cardiac failure or fluid overload). 2. Patients aged 18-90 years of age. 3. Patients with ARDS who are intubated and are on invasive mechanical ventilation.
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: 1. More than 24 hours elapsed since admission to ICU with ARDS. 2. ARDS patients on - corticosteroid and tocilizumab, sarilumab, disease-modifying anti- rheumatoid drugs (which can alter levels of inflammatory mediators). 3. Patients with hematological malignancies (altered lymphocyte, neutrophil counts) 4. Patients diagnosed with cardiogenic pulmonary oedema (which can alter the lung ultrasound findings). 5. Patients not expected to survive the next 24-48 hours with the SOFA score on ARDS diagnosis being >= 22. 6. Non-invasive Ventilator (NIV) ARDS patients.
